Using reflective case narrative methodology to assess an introductory NVivo workshop

ABSTRACT

Despite the varied approaches to qualitative data analysis software (QDAS) instruction, teaching QDAS remains a challenge as students’ skills with digital tools and understanding of qualitative research vary. In this paper, we report on our experiences providing QDAS instruction via an introductory NVivo 11 workshop to graduate students. To report on our experiences, we use a reflective case narrative, which relied on a pre-workshop participant questionnaire, a review of workshop documents, an end-of-course evaluation, and participant interviews. Findings from our study indicate the success of our workshop was the result of explicit workshop goals, independent work time, engaging activities, pre-workshop planning, and dynamic co-teaching. Challenges to our workshop were also revealed and included differences in operating systems and our two-consecutive, full-day workshop format. Based on these findings, recommendations for QDAS instruction are offered.
